Disconnect the FS series camcorder from the computer
To ensure reliable operation and data integrity the FS series camcorders cannot be powered off while they are actively connected to a computer. To turn the camcorder off please use the proper safe device removal procedures for your computers operating system and then disconnect the USB cable. Once the cable has been removed the camera will then be able to be powered off.

Can you use the Compact Power Adapter overseas?
You can connect the dedicated compact power adapter or battery charger to a power supply of between 100 and 240 V AC, 50/60 Hz. However, you need a plug adapter to use the camcorder in a country where the power plug shape is different from that of your own country. (Please note that depending on the region, the plug shape may be different even in the same country.)

How do i get parts for my camcorder?
Items purchased directly from the Parts Ordering Center are not returnable, and there is a chance that they will not correct your issue. Spare parts sold through the Parts Ordering Center do not come with installation or setup instructions. We ask that you allow us to troubleshoot your unit first in order to help diagnose the cause of the issue you are having.
